Tempe, Arizona, known for its vibrant university atmosphere and sun-drenched desert landscapes, offers a surprising twist on team building through Simply Smashing LLC’s unique, interactive experiences. Positioned in the heart of this bustling city, Simply Smashing delivers hands-on group activities that break from the traditional with sessions like “4's a Party!”, “Splatter Date Night Experience!”, “Double Trouble”, and “Office Space.” These events engage participants in creative, lively ways—smashing pottery, splattering paint, and challenging team dynamics to spark collaboration and fun.

Adventure Tips

Dress for Mess

Wear clothes that you don't mind getting paint or ceramic dust on, since creativity here gets hands-on and messy.

Book Groups in Advance

Their experiences are popular for events, so reserve your spot early especially on weekends and evenings.

Hydrate Before Arrival

Arizona’s dry climate can be dehydrating, so drink plenty of water even if the sessions are indoors.

Plan Transportation

Tempe traffic can peak around university hours; plan your arrival time accordingly to avoid delays.
